SEN Teaching Assistant
Location: East London, Ilford
Start Date January 2023
Role: Full time
Pay: £75-95
Are you passionate to support children with special educational needs?
Are you passionate about supporting children with Autism and social and emotional needs?
Are you a supportive role model?
If you answered yes to the above, then have a look at more details!
We are currently working with an "outstanding" community SEN school at the heart of Ilford who are currently looking for proactive and energetic SEN teaching assistant who can support children with Autism, between the ages of 4-19. This role requires you to work 1:1 with children during daily tasks. The school has facilities like a sensory, wellbeing and relaxation room to support children through their daily activities. We are looking for friendly and hands-on support staff who genuinely want to create a difference in young people's lives.
The Ideal SEN teaching assistant:
Experience working with SEN children or similar positions like youth work, mentoring, policing, care work and social care
Academic background in Psychology or other social sciences
Flexible and energetic
Positive role model and supporting pupil progression
